Feud Costs Taxpayers For OSHA Retreat In 1991

The General Accounting Office reports an 11 075 retreat cost for OSHA at Bonnie Castle Resort in January 1991, covering travel, meals, lodging, and a Washington consultant. Workers stayed in rooms with Jacuzzi and cable TV while a four day session aimed to boost morale and ease friction.

Urban League decries Salina pool racism policy

The Urban League criticizes Lehr Park Pool access rules barring nonresidents, saying identifying requirements discriminate. Salina town officials defend legality if all nonresidents are excluded, with similar limits last year. The policy affects Lehr Park while three other town pools remain open to all residents.

Wet July Ends With Record Coolest Day Yet

Another inch of rain drenched the area as July closed among the wettest on record. Rainfall nearly doubled the average, with July registering 9.32 inches, the third coolest on record at 63 degrees on July 23. August may stay cooler with a 55 percent chance of below normal temps and potential heavy rainfall.

47 felons regain gun rights and commit new crimes

In three years the federal government approved gun rights restoration for 47 felons. After restoration, they faced crimes including sexual assault, drug trafficking, and robbery. Names and offenses were released by three Democratic congressmen urging cuts to the program.

Dinosaur Bar-B-Q Becomes Downtown Hit With Blues Night

Michael Rotella and John Stage run the Dinosaur Bar-B-Q at West Willow and North Franklin. Four years after opening a dingy corner spot, the restaurant now draws crowds daily and nightly with a smoky vibe, blues chanteuse Big Time Sarah, and a mix of bikers, students, and professionals. Rotella notes the place is always busy as lounge meets lunch spot.

Heart Disease Deaths Drop Sharply Across Groups

Federal health officials report a nearly 24 percent fall in heart disease deaths from 1980 to 1988, with larger declines among black men and white women. Scientists cite socioeconomic factors as a possible explanation for varying rates across groups and regions.
